图书介绍
C语言程序设计PDF|Epub|txt|kindle电子书版本网盘下载
![C语言程序设计](https://www.shukui.net/cover/25/30167264.jpg)
- 王伟,王黎明编著 著
- 出版社: 北京:中国水利水电出版社
- ISBN:9787508455075
- 出版时间:2008
- 标注页数:192页
- 文件大小:38MB
- 文件页数:202页
- 主题词:C语言-程序设计-高等学校:技术学校-教材
PDF下载
下载说明
C语言程序设计P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 C程序设计初步知识1
C语言的发展过程及其特点1
C语言程序的基本标识符2
C程序举例3
C语言的编译环境5
本章小结10
习题11
第2章 数据类型、运算符和表达式12
C语言的数据类型12
常量12
整型常量12
实型常量13
字符型常量13
符号常量15
变量16
整型变量17
实型变量19
字符型变量20
对变量赋初值22
运算符和表达式22
算术运算符和算术表达式22
自增、自减运算符23
赋值运算符和赋值表达式24
逗号运算符和逗号表达式26
条件运算符26
长度运算符27
数据类型的转换27
自动转换28
强制类型转换28
本章小结29
习题30
第3章 数据的输入输出32
字符输入输出函数32
格式输入输出函数33
格式输出函数33
格式输入函数scanf38
应用举例40
本章小结41
习题42
第4章 C语言程序的基本控制结构44
程序的3种基本控制结构44
顺序结构44
表达式语句和空语句45
复合语句45
顺序结构程序设计45
选择结构46
关系运算和关系表达式46
逻辑运算和逻辑表达式47
if语句48
switch语句52
程序举例53
循环结构55
while循环语句(“当型”循环)55
do-while循环语句(“直到型”循环)56
for循环语句57
循环的嵌套58
循环的退出60
应用举例62
本章小结64
习题64
第5章 数组68
一维数组68
一维数组的定义68
一维数组的引用68
一维数组的初始化69
一维数组的应用70
二维数组71
二维数组的定义71
二维数组的引用71
二维数组的初始化72
二维数组的应用72
字符数组和字符串73
字符数组的定义73
字符数组的初始化73
字符数组的引用74
字符串及其常用函数74
程序举例78
本章小结81
习题81
第6章 函数83
函数分类83
函数84
函数的定义84
函数的声明85
函数的参数86
函数的值88
函数调用88
函数的调用方式88
函数的嵌套调用89
函数的递归调用89
函数和数组91
变量的作用域93
局部变量93
全局变量95
变量的存储类别96
动态存储和静态存储96
自动变量97
寄存器变量98
外部变量99
静态变量100
内部函数和外部函数102
本章小结103
习题103
第7章 指针108
指针的概念108
指针和指针变量的关系108
指针变量定义109
指针运算符109
指针变量赋值(初始化)110
指针变量的引用111
指针变量的运算112
指针变量和函数113
指针变量和函数参数113
指针变量和返回指针值的函数114
指针变量和数组115
一维数组和指针变量115
二维数组和指针变量118
字符串和指针变量120
指针数组122
指针数组的定义和引用122
指针数组用作main函数的形参123
程序举例123
本章小结125
习题126
第8章 结构体和共用体130
结构体130
结构体类型的定义130
结构体变量的定义131
结构体变量的引用132
结构体数组133
定义结构体数组133
结构体数组的初始化134
指向结构体类型数据的指针136
指向结构体变量的指针136
指向结构体数组的指针137
链表138
简单链表的定义和使用138
动态链表140
共用体144
本章小结146
习题146
第9章 位运算149
位运算符149
按位与运算149
按位或运算150
按位异或运算150
求反运算151
左移运算151
右移运算152
位域152
本章小结154
习题155
第10章 文件157
文件概述157
文件的打开与关闭158
文件的读写160
fgetc()函数和fputc()函数160
fgets()函数和fputs()函数161
fwrite()函数和fread()函数163
fscanf()函数和fprintf()函数165
文件的定位166
错误处理167
本章小结167
习题167
第11章 实验168
实验1熟悉Turbo C 2.0系统168
实验2数据结构169
实验3数据的输入输出171
实验4 C语言程序的基本控制结构172
实验5数组174
实验6函数176
实验7指针179
实验8结构体180
实验9位运算183
实验10文件183
附录一 常用字符ASCII码对照表185
附录二 C语言中的关键字186
附录三 运算符187
附录四 常用C库函数189
参考文献192